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2967002 84127749 582862837
18806 0481304421
18806 0481304421
595 63 00251301 3913488
All about undefined
Interested in learning more?
18806 0481304421
595 63 00251301 3913488
See more
68059123 710587 86708951959
2105770 546 51
See more
23140635384 660 9391617139
431662121 057 7104842236 393648273
See more